Dryness

At some point in your life, you might discover that although you have managed to happily orgasm throughout many years, it is no longer the case. Despite the adequate clitoral stimulation, your vagina might remain dry as the desert sand. You might be confused, asking yourself whether it is possible that your body has decided to switch to being asexual without informing your first, thus making any attempts to reach orgasms futile. Or, perhaps, your old fetishes are no longer able to sate your kinky mind?

Although you shouldn't rule out any potential causes, many women experience similar problems in their life. How wet you get depends on your estrogen levels, and those tend to fluctuate depending on your age.

However, the medications that you are taking could also have some unwanted consequences. It is especially common for hormonal birth control pills to cause vaginal dryness. If your doctor confirms this hypothesis, we recommend switching to a different type of birth control upon their advice.

Vulnerability

Some women don't have the slightest problem reaching orgasm when they are alone in their bedroom, with or without the help of sex toys; however, during sex, their body might refuse to cooperate, no matter the amount of the G-spot stimulation.

Similarly as in the previous example, the cause might be hidden in the psyche. If you invite another person to your bedroom with the intention of having sex, then even though you might be craving the act, your body might feel uncomfortable. Perhaps you don't know the other person well enough to show them your vulnerable side?

Maybe you are afraid that orgasm may feel good enough for you to make a funny face, and you are hell-bent on keeping things serious? In this case, it might be necessary for you to get to know the other person a little better before achieving orgasm during sex could become possible.

Or, you might need to stop taking yourself so seriously. No person looks dignified while having their genitals licked and sucked, and it most probably even applies to Sir David Attenborough.
